World English Bible

Proverbs 8 (WEBP)

[1] Doesn’t wisdom cry out? Doesn’t understanding raise her voice?
[2] On the top of high places by the way, where the paths meet, she stands.
[3] Beside the gates, at the entry of the city, at the entry doors, she cries aloud:
[4] “I call to you men! I send my voice to the sons of mankind.
[5] You simple, understand prudence! You fools, be of an understanding heart!
[6] Hear, for I will speak excellent things. The opening of my lips is for right things.
[7] For my mouth speaks truth. Wickedness is an abomination to my lips.
[8] All the words of my mouth are in righteousness. There is nothing crooked or perverse in them.
[9] They are all plain to him who understands, right to those who find knowledge.
[10] Receive my instruction rather than silver, knowledge rather than choice gold.
[11] For wisdom is better than rubies. All the things that may be desired can’t be compared to it.
[12] “I, wisdom, have made prudence my dwelling. Find out knowledge and discretion.
[13] The fear of Yahweh is to hate evil. I hate pride, arrogance, the evil way, and the perverse mouth.
[14] Counsel and sound knowledge are mine. I have understanding and power.
[15] By me kings reign, and princes decree justice.
[16] By me princes rule, nobles, and all the righteous rulers of the earth.
[17] I love those who love me. Those who seek me diligently will find me.
[18] With me are riches, honor, enduring wealth, and prosperity.
[19] My fruit is better than gold, yes, than fine gold, my yield than choice silver.
[20] I walk in the way of righteousness, in the middle of the paths of justice,
[21] that I may give wealth to those who love me. I fill their treasuries.
[22] “Yahweh possessed me in the beginning of his work, before his deeds of old.
[23] I was set up from everlasting, from the beginning, before the earth existed.
[24] When there were no depths, I was born, when there were no springs abounding with water.
[25] Before the mountains were settled in place, before the hills, I was born;
[26] while as yet he had not made the earth, nor the fields, nor the beginning of the dust of the world.
[27] When he established the heavens, I was there. When he set a circle on the surface of the deep,
[28] when he established the clouds above, when the springs of the deep became strong,
[29] when he gave to the sea its boundary, that the waters should not violate his commandment, when he marked out the foundations of the earth,
[30] then I was the craftsman by his side. I was a delight day by day, always rejoicing before him,
[31] rejoicing in his whole world. My delight was with the sons of men.
[32] “Now therefore, my sons, listen to me, for blessed are those who keep my ways.
[33] Hear instruction, and be wise. Don’t refuse it.
[34] Blessed is the man who hears me, watching daily at my gates, waiting at my door posts.
[35] For whoever finds me finds life, and will obtain favor from Yahweh.
[36] But he who sins against me wrongs his own soul. All those who hate me love death.”

Young’s Literal Translation

Proverbs 8 (YLT)

[1] Doth not wisdom call? And understanding give forth her voice?
[2] At the head of high places by the way, Between the paths she hath stood,
[3] At the side of the gates, at the mouth of the city, The entrance of the openings, she crieth aloud,
[4] ‘Unto you, O men, I call, And my voice is unto the sons of men.
[5] Understand, ye simple ones, prudence, And ye fools, understand the heart,
[6] Hearken, for noble things I speak, And the opening of my lips is uprightness.
[7] For truth doth my mouth utter, And an abomination to my lips is wickedness.
[8] In righteousness are all the sayings of my mouth, Nothing in them is froward and perverse.
[9] All of them are plain to the intelligent, And upright to those finding knowledge.
[10] Receive my instruction, and not silver, And knowledge rather than choice gold.
[11] For better is wisdom than rubies, Yea, all delights are not comparable with it.
[12] I, wisdom, have dwelt with prudence, And a knowledge of devices I find out.
[13] The fear of Jehovah is to hate evil; Pride, and arrogance, and an evil way, And a froward mouth, I have hated.
[14] Mine is counsel and substance, I am understanding, I have might.
[15] By me kings reign, and princes decree righteousness,
[16] By me do chiefs rule, and nobles, All judges of the earth.
[17] I love those loving me, And those seeking me earnestly do find me.
[18] Wealth and honour are with me, Lasting substance and righteousness.
[19] Better is my fruit than gold, even fine gold, And mine increase than choice silver.
[20] In a path of righteousness I cause to walk, In midst of paths of judgment,
[21] To cause my lovers to inherit substance, Yea, their treasures I fill.
[22] Jehovah possessed me-the beginning of His way, Before His works since then.
[23] From the age I was anointed, from the first, From former states of the earth.
[24] In there being no depths, I was brought forth, In there being no fountains heavy with waters,
[25] Before mountains were sunk, Before heights, I was brought forth.
[26] While He had not made the earth, and out-places, And the top of the dusts of the world.
[27] In His preparing the heavens I am there, In His decreeing a circle on the face of the deep,
[28] In His strengthening clouds above, In His making strong fountains of the deep,
[29] In His setting for the sea its limit, And the waters transgress not His command, In His decreeing the foundations of earth,
[30] Then I am near Him, a workman, And I am a delight-day by day. Rejoicing before Him at all times,
[31] Rejoicing in the habitable part of His earth, And my delights are with the sons of men.
[32] And now, ye sons, hearken to me, Yea, happy are they who keep my ways.
[33] Hear instruction, and be wise, and slight not.
[34] O the happiness of the man hearkening to me, To watch at my doors day by day, To watch at the door-posts of my entrance.
[35] For whoso is finding me, hath found life, And bringeth out good-will from Jehovah.
[36] And whoso is missing me, is wronging his soul, All hating me have loved death!
